Utrecht

Utrecht (Dutch pronunciation: [ˈytrɛxt] ( listen), English pronunciation: /ˈjuːtrɛkt/) city and municipality is the capital and most populous city of the Dutch province of Utrecht. It is located in the eastern corner of the Randstad conurbation, and is the fourth largest city of the Netherlands with a population of 316,448 on 1 February 2012.
